2019-11-07net: hns: Fix the stray netpoll locks causing deadlock in NAPI pathSalil Mehta
This patch fixes the problem of the spin locks, originally meant for the netpoll path of hns driver, causing deadlock in the normal NAPI poll path. The issue happened due to the presence of the stray leftover spin lock code related to the netpoll, whose support was earlier removed from the HNS[1], got activated due to enabling of NET_POLL_CONTROLLER switch. Earlier background: The netpoll handling code originally had this bug(as identified by Marc Zyngier[2]) of wrong spin lock API being used which did not disable the interrupts and hence could cause locking issues. i.e. if the lock were first acquired in context to thread like 'ip' util and this lock if ever got later acquired again in context to the interrupt context like TX/RX (Interrupts could always pre-empt the lock holding task and acquire the lock again) and hence could cause deadlock. Proposed Solution: 1. If the netpoll was enabled in the HNS driver, which is not right now, we could have simply used spin_[un]lock_irqsave() 2. But as netpoll is disabled, therefore, it is best to get rid of the existing locks and stray code for now. This should solve the problem reported by Marc. 2019-09-11net: hns3: fix shaper parameter algorithmYonglong Liu
Currently when hns3 driver configures the tm shaper to limit bandwidth below 20Mbit using the parameters calculated by hclge_shaper_para_calc(), the actual bandwidth limited by tm hardware module is not accurate enough, for example, 1.28 Mbit when the user is configuring 1 Mbit. This patch adjusts the ir_calc to be closer to ir, and always calculate the ir_b parameter when user is configuring a small bandwidth. Also, removes an unnecessary parenthesis when calculating denominator. 2019-09-06net: hns3: fix error VF index when setting VLAN offloadJian Shen
In original codes, the VF index used incorrectly in function hclge_set_vlan_rx_offload_cfg() and hclge_set_vlan_rx_offload_cfg(). When VF id is greater than 8, for example 9, it will set the same bit with VF id 1. This patch fixes it by using vport->vport_id % HCLGE_VF_NUM_PER_CMD / HCLGE_VF_NUM_PER_BYTE as the array index, instead of vport->vport_id / HCLGE_VF_NUM_PER_CMD. 2019-08-29net: hns3: not allow SSU loopback while execute ethtool -t devYufeng Mo
The current loopback mode is to add 0x1F to the SMAC address as the DMAC address and enable the promiscuous mode. However, if the VF address is the same as the DMAC address, the loopback test fails. Loopback can be enabled in three places: SSU, MAC, and serdes. By default, SSU loopback is enabled, so if the SMAC and the DMAC are the same, the packets are looped back in the SSU. If SSU loopback is disabled, packets can reach MAC even if SMAC is the same as DMAC. Therefore, this patch disables the SSU loopback before the loopback test. In this way, the SMAC and DMAC can be the same, and the promiscuous mode does not need to be enabled. And this is not valid in version 0x20. This patch also uses a macro to replace 0x1F.
